1. EKWB EK Quantum Lumen 7" LCD - nickel-plated

EK-Quantum Lumen 7" LCD - Nickel is a Quantum series 7-inch IPS screen that is a stylish and functional addition to any liquid cooling setup. The display is recognized as an additional desktop by your operating system, offering a handy way to display any content you want or monitor the computer's vital parameters like component and coolant temperatures, fan RPM, core frequency, and more. It can be mounted on standard 120mm fan spacing in the PC case or used as an external display.

This monitor uses a high-quality IPS screen designed for mounting inside the PC case or as an external monitor for temperature, hardware load, and other information or pure aesthetics. It has a wide SVGA resolution of 1024 x 600 pixels. Its diagonal measures 7 inches, with the IPS panel type providing superior viewing angles and vivid colors. It connects to the PC through an HDMI 2.0 cable included in the package and an internal Type-A USB 2.0 port for in-case usage. Another USB Type-C cable is also included for using Lumen as an external display.

Grooves and notches are strategically placed on the back side of the screen to hide the cables and ease cable management, creating a sleek look and feel. The frame of Lumen is CNC-machined from a single large chunk of 20mm-thick aluminum that measures 195mm long and 115mm wide.

The sturdy nickel-plated aluminum frame offers three mounting positions with hole spacing aligned with 120mm fans. This allows the screen to be moved up and down or centered, depending on your preference, while ensuring a high degree of compatibility with most modern cases. This 7" monitor can also be mounted on the EK-Loop Angled Bracket 120mm to allow 90-degree rotation and additional positioning options.
 

2. EKWB EK-Loop Vertical Graphics Card Holder EVO, PCIe Riser Cable 4th Gen

Position your graphics card with water cooler vertically. Suitable for cases with at least four to six slot height. For graphics cards with a maximum height of three slots. Backward-compatible 4th generation riser cable. Long flat ribbon cable for clean cable management.

The EK Water Blocks EK-Loop Vertical Graphics Card Holder EVO (Shifted) in detail: With the black vertical graphics card holder EVO (Shifted) from EK Water Blocks, a graphics card can be installed vertically in a tower case. It consists of a PCIe riser cable and a special PCI slot bracket. The adapter bracket is mounted slightly offset at the PCI slots of the case. At least four to six PCI slots should be free for installation, and the graphics cards must not exceed a height of three slots.

The riser cable connects the graphics card to the PCIe slot on the motherboard. Its x16 slot is electrically connected with a full 16 data lanes, providing the full bandwidth for graphics cards. A 20 cm long, flexible flat ribbon cable is used for data transmission. The small board with the PCIe x16 card slot is secured to the graphics card holder with two screws.

Technical details:
- Material: Steel (powder-coated)
- Color: Black
- Cable length: 200 mm
- Connectors: Plug: PCIe with 16 lanes, Socket: PCIe with 16 lanes angled at 90°
- Supported PCI Express standards: 1.x, 2.x, 3.0, 4.0
- Maximum height of the graphics card: 3 slots.

3. EKWB EK-Scalar Dual 2-Slot

The EK-Scalar Dual 2-Slot is designed to connect two graphics cards equipped with EK-Vector or EK-FC water coolers. The terminal connects directly to the respective VGA coolers, and additional fittings, seals, tubes, or hoses are required.

In this version, the terminal is made of transparent acrylic glass, allowing a view of the flowing coolant. The flow into this bridge is parallel. Therefore, two tubes run through the connector vertically, with water being supplied on one side, splitting, and flowing through both VGA coolers, and then being discharged on the other side. Advantage: Both receive evenly cold water. Disadvantage: However, with less pressure.

Note: The terminal is only compatible with EK-Vector or EK-FC series water coolers.

Technical details:
- Material: Acrylic glass
- VGA cooler connections: 2x
- Thread: G1/4 inch
